Location: Somerset, 3 days per week onsite

Overview: We are looking for a talented Snowflake Data Engineer to join our growing data team. Reporting to the BI & Data Manager, you will play a key role in the technical build of our new enterprise data warehouse. Your focus will be on hands-on development: building scalable pipelines, designing efficient data models, and ensuring a high-quality Snowflake environment to support business intelligence, analytics, and data-driven decision-making.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Develop and optimize data pipelines and ETL processes into Snowflake.
  • Build, structure, and maintain the Snowflake data warehouse.
  • Work closely with the BI & Data Manager to align technical solutions with strategic goals.
  • Implement data modelling best practices to support reporting and analysis needs.
  • Ensure data integrity, security, and performance within the Snowflake environment.
  • Collaborate with business analysts, developers, and stakeholders across the business.

Skills and Experience Required:

  • Strong experience working with Snowflake in a data engineering capacity.
  • Expertise in SQL and ETL/ELT development.
  • Familiarity with cloud platforms (AWS, Azure, or GCP).
  • Experience with data modelling (e.g., star/snowflake schema).
  • Knowledge of best practices in data governance, security, and performance optimization.
  • Ability to work collaboratively but also drive work independently.
